探索 Vue2 应用开发新维度: Raintao 的 Vue2_app
去发现同类优质开源项目:https://gitcode.com/
在前端开发领域,Vue.js 已经成为许多开发者首选的框架之一,其简洁的语法和强大的功能使得构建复杂应用变得轻而易举。今天我们要聚焦的是一个基于 Vue2 的开源项目——。这个项目不仅是一个学习和实践 Vue2 技术的好资源,同时也为开发者提供了一个快速搭建 Web 应用的基础框架。
项目简介
Raintao 的 Vue2_app 是一个精简版的 Vue2 项目模板,包含了 Vue2 及其相关生态的常用组件库(如 Vuex 和 Vue Router),旨在帮助开发者快速启动新的 Vue2 项目。通过这个项目,你可以学习如何组织和管理大型 Vue2 项目的结构,同时也能节省初始化项目时的时间。
技术分析
1. Vue2 核心
该项目基于 Vue2,利用了 Vue 的响应式数据绑定、组件化、指令系统等特性。Vue2 提供了一种声明式的编程方式,使得代码更易于理解和维护。
2. Vuex 状态管理
Vuex 被用于集中管理应用的状态,它提供了统一的方式来读取和修改状态,确保了状态的一致性。在这个项目中,你可以看到如何创建 actions, mutations, 和 state,以及如何在组件中使用它们。
3. Vue Router 路由管理
Vue Router 作为 Vue 的官方路由库,负责应用的页面导航和路由配置。项目中的路由设置展示了如何定义不同页面路径,并处理页面间的跳转逻辑。
4. 配套工具
此外,项目还集成了 webpack
和 babel
,用于编译 ES6+ 代码和转换 Vue 单文件组件,确保浏览器兼容性。同时还包含了 ESlint,以保持代码质量。
应用场景
- 快速原型设计 - 如果你需要快速搭建一个 MVP (最小可行产品),Vue2_app 可以作为一个优秀的起点。
- 教育与学习 - 对于初学者来说,这是一个了解并实践 Vue2 + Vuex + Vue Router 结合使用的理想范例。
- 项目重构 - 当需要将现有项目迁移到 Vue2 生态时,可以参考此项目结构。
特点
- 清晰的项目结构 - 代码结构遵循最佳实践,有利于团队协作和长期维护。
- 预配置的工具链 - 包含所有必要的构建和开发工具,如热加载、代码压缩等,开箱即用。
- 丰富的示例 - 在项目中包含了一些常见功能的示例,便于理解和学习。
结论
Raintao 的 Vue2_app 是一个宝贵的资源,无论是新手还是有经验的开发者,都可以从中获益。通过实际操作这个项目,你不仅可以提升 Vue2 开发技能,还能更好地理解和掌握现代前端项目的工作流程。现在就前往 克隆项目开始你的探索之旅吧!
去发现同类优质开源项目:https://gitcode.com/
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考